Police in Preah Sihanouk’s Prey Nop district yesterday nabbed a pair of alleged animal rustlers who may be responsible for a spree of livestock thefts.
The suspects, aged 22 and 30, were arrested during a patrol, questioned and sent to provincial court. Police confiscated two buffaloes, one cow and a motorbike.
Authorities had been on the lookout for the alleged thieves since three farmers in a local village repeatedly complained about stolen animals.
